Did Fabian Zetterlund‘s contract counter result in him being dealt on the deadline?
Sheng Peng: Fabian Zetterlund’s agent Claude Lemieux after he was traded to the Ottawa Senators by the San Jose Sharks: “They did make us a suggestion early this yr & we selected to attend for after the season. They requested once more to speak contract extension, we agreed & countered a number of days in the past. I can’t let you know if the commerce was the results of the counteroffer or not.”
Murray Pam: “Sounds as if Sharks didn’t need to pay as much as $2.8-3M which Zetterlund ought to obtain subsequent season.”
The Los Angeles Kings weren’t interested by buying and selling Brandt Clark
Russell Morgan: Los Angeles Kings GM Rob Blake mentioned that they by no means had any curiosity in buying and selling defenseman Brandt Clark.
Austin Stanovich: Blake scoffed at the concept that the Kings had been open to buying and selling Clarke forward of the deadline. It’s doable that groups referred to as the Kings, however don’t assume Clarke was in play.
Evander Kane‘s no-movement clause switched to a 16-team commerce record
Zach Laing of the Oilers Nation: Every week earlier than the March seventh NHL commerce deadline, Evander Kane’s no-movement clause switched to a 16-team commerce record. Elliotte Friedman reported that the Oilers referred to as groups to see if anybody was within the 33-year-old.
Kane has been on the LTIR all season, and Kane has been desirous to play earlier than the tip of the common season. It was introduced on Friday that he’s out for the common season.
One group thought of Kane, in response to Friedman on his 32 Ideas: The Podcast.
